I'm building my first quad (Mr Steele config) ImmersionRC Alien 5" etc.
My Alien PDB has not got any continuity issues. The - to - terminals is a closed circuit and so is all the + to + terminals. The PDB - and + is open and not connected when testing continuity. All good there.
The Kiss ESC is another story . I've soldered clearly making sure no solder is connecting or bridging across anything, however i'm getting 70% resistance connection when checking - and + Kiss ESC terminals with a constant continuity beep that never disappears.
I understand a short beep could occur due to capacitors charging but I don't think this should cause a constant continuity beep.
Has anyone else soldered and used Kiss 24A Race Editions ESCs and got a closed circuit when testing - and + terminals?
Have I introduced too much temp into the ESC and nuked a chip causing a short?
Everything I've read and watched tells me there shouldn't be any continuity between + and - terminals anywhere on the quad. On the Kiss ESC, I should be expecting infinite resistance (open circuit) on the + and - terminals, yes?
